Get cooking with GFCF pancakes

- GFCF flour mix: 2/3 cup sorghum flour, 1/3 cup tapioca starch
- 2 tbsp sugar
- 2 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p salt
- 2 tbsp applesauce
- 1 tsp cinnamon
- 2 tbsp oil
- 1 tbsp ground flax seed
- 1/3 cup CF milk or water
- 2-3 tbsp more liquid, CF milk or water
Note, I do not use egg or an egg substitute in the recipe, nor do I use xanthan gum. The recipe works fine.
Combine the dry ingredients, then the wet. Mix the batter with a whisk.
Add some oil to a pan and pre-heat. If they become sticky in the pan, add more oil in between pancakes.
